System map
Technical capability, enabling infrastructure, evidence and governance must be considered together.
Models can assist underwriting, claims, service and portfolio analysis when suitability rules, evidence retrieval and accountable human review frame each consequential recommendation.
Trusted data, payment rails, identity services, risk systems, audit records, contractual rules and regulated institutions form the surrounding system.
Validation should examine outcome quality, calibration, suitability, explainability, fairness and performance through changing economic and claims conditions.
Discriminatory proxies, hallucinated advice and correlated model behaviour can harm customers or create institution-wide exposure. System-wide governance also requires: Consumer protection, market integrity, explainability, accountability, competition and clear limits on delegated financial authority are central.

Insurance adoption
FUURAA synthesisEIOPA’s survey finds widespread active use among European insurers, while many deployments remain proofs of concept. The market is expanding through controlled rollout rather than immediate full automation.
Insurance AI roadmaps should preserve staged validation and clear production gates.
